The rapid growth of the Indoor Agriculture industry and its Controlled Environment Agriculture (CEA) facilities, demand a precise and complicated set of HVAC design requirements. Essentially, all HVAC systems that meet these design requirements would fall under the category of “custom.” As a result, significant risks for operators remain with: scalability; high CapEx; and high OpEx. Harvest Air is a patent pending system that leverages proven technology and is designed specifically for use in CEA facilities. Harvest Air provides value to operators in three key categories: 1. The lowest total cost among qualified systems: Initial CapEx reductions of ~25% and up to 75% reductions in annual OpEx. 2. Improved scalability and increased speed to market: Factory built and tested, with a production capacity of 100 units per month. 3. Unrivalled control of your production environment Zero transfer of outside air to the cultivation environment, and a completely packaged and factory tested control system. At the heart of the patent pending Harvest Air design is the HarvestWheel; a total energy wheel used for indirect air-to-air economization. Indirect air-to-air economization is the use of outside air to cool and dehumidify the cultivation space, without bringing the outside air into the space. The production capabilities behind the Harvest Air units extend to complete supply chain ownership by centralizing the wheel manufacturing, and complete unit controls integration, under one roof. The result is a completely packaged and factory-tested system that ships and installs as a single piece.
